Mumbai: Fire breaks out in Marol area; 3 injured, 3 vehicles burnt to ashes

Mumbai (Maharashtra) | March 9, 2025 3:42:56 AM IST
A massive fire broke out in Mumbai's Marol area on the early hours of Sunday.

The reason for the fire is believed to be leakage in the gas pipeline. A car, rickshaw and a bike were burnt down into ashes.

Assistant Divisional Fire Officer, SK Sawant said that three people have been injured in the fire and they have been sent for treatment.

"We received the fire information at around 12:30 a.m. The incident took place where BMC work was underway. We reached the spot upon receiving information. We received information that three people had been injured and they have been sent for treatment," the official told reporters.

Further details are awaited from the incident. (ANI)
